Kumar underplays it in an OTT Bombay-set murder story with some adventurous camerawork Shamelessly tarting up a proper-life society scandal,this period melodrama suggests director Dharmendra Suresh Desai has swallowed recent Todd Haynes projects whole. Akshay Kumar is the eponymous navy man who enters a police station in ancient Bombay (as it was in 1958) and confesses to shooting the industrialist who cuckolded him – a simple crime of passion, complicated by gutter-press stirring, or institutional corruption and the accused’s officer-grade tactical nous.
